In this special new year's episode, I chat with my friend Heather Stimmler, founder of Secrets of Paris. Heather's favourite market street is the rue Mouffetard, a street which goes back to Roman times. This is the neighbourhood described in the first pages of Ernest Hemingway's classic A Moveable Feast--this is where he bought clementines and chestnuts to eat while he wrote. Heather and I talk about bread, beer, and butchers, walking from the Place Conte-Escarpe down the street to SAINT-MEDARD church.
